Transaction 138cfa781706422b5d630fe445e19a245ac2443aeed56e30826fd9921e249fc5

1 Input
2 Outputs
  • 138cfa781706422b5d630fe445e19a245ac2443aeed56e30826fd9921e249fc5:0
  • value  7236546
    address  3CLU7fNd4dQSuMh4uYW1uqgZ6UaKwcUWeh
  • 138cfa781706422b5d630fe445e19a245ac2443aeed56e30826fd9921e249fc5:1
  • value  2760214
    address  32FomVH8rb6o4qupRQVLJ7A2W7XhQ1m5hD